This is a barrel nut only for the SG22 (SpaceGat 22) or similar uppers with the same style printed barrel nut. This is really only for a specific circumstance which I am currently facing. I am lazy and don't have a vice anymore to remove muzzle attachments, so in order to add one of my barrels to my most recent builds, I cut the barrel nut in half, added a bottom ridge and slots, and made an outer "sleeve" to slip over the two pieces of barrel nuts. You can either use the included "sleeve" once you put the two halves over your barrel and then thread it on, or you can use your foregrip to act as the sleeve. Just make sure if it doesn't fit snug, use some electrical tape or consider epoxying the two halves to that foregrip and dedicate it to that barrel. If you're using the sleeve, your printed foregrips will NOT fit! I am working on a newly sized foregrip to fix this issue. This is a very niche print, so I don't expect many people to use it, but it works well and is worth a shot. Print with supports, everything is already set up in proper orientation.
